CS4811
3. FUNCTIONAL DESCRIPTION
3.1 Overview
The CS4811 is a complete audio subsystem on a
chip, integrating a proprietary 24-bit audio process-
ing engine with large on chip RAM memories and
a single channel 24-bit audio codec.
The delta-sigma ADC includes linear phase digital
anti-aliasing filters and only requires a single-pole
external passive filter.
The sigma-delta DAC includes a switched-capaci-
tor anti-image filter and requires an external 2nd or
3rd order active filter that can be easily integrated
into the output differential-to-single-ended con-
verter circuit.
The serial control port is designed to accommodate
I2C® or SPI interfaces for stand-alone operation
with an external non-volatile memory.
3.2 Analog Inputs
3.2.1 Line Level Inputs
AIN+ and AIN- are the differential line level ana-
log inputs (See Figure 3). These pins are internally
biased to the CMOUT voltage of 2.3 V. A DC
blocking capacitor placed in series with the input
pins allows signals centered around 0 V to be input
to the CS4811. Figure 3 shows operation with a
single-ended input source. This source may be sup-
plied to either the positive or negative input as long
as the unused input is connected to ground through
capacitors as shown. When operated with single-
ended inputs, distortion will increase at input levels
higher than -1 dB Full Scale. If better performance
is required, a single-ended-to-differential convert-
er, shown in Figure 6, may be used. This circuit
provides unity gain, DC blocking on the input and
anti-alias filtering.
The OVL output pin asserts when the analog input
is out-of-range.
3.2.2 Digital High Pass Filter
In DC coupled systems, a small DC offset may ex-
ist between the input circuitry and the A/D con-
verters. The CS4811 includes a high pass filter
after the decimator to remove these DC compo-
nents. The high pass filter response, given in High
Pass Filter Characteristics, scales linearly with
sample rate. Thus, the -3 dB frequency at a
44.1 kHz sample rate will be equal to 44.1/48 times
that at a sample rate of 48 kHz.
